The story of Patrick Clement Burns began in 1888 in Tyrone, Le Sueur, Minnesota. In 1900, Patrick Clement Burns resided in Tyrone, Le Sueur, Minnesota, USA. In 1905, Patrick Clement Burns resided in Tyrone, Le Sueur, Minnesota, USA. Patrick Clement Burns married Mary Ann Mccourtney, and had children including Clement Burns, Donald Francis Burns, Elizabeth J Burns, Harold Burns, Mary Helen Burns. Patrick Clement Burns passed away in 1943 in Saint Thomas, Le Sueur County, Minnesota, United States of America.
